You can save electricity by unplugging chargers when they are not in use. All the chargers you use for mp3 players, cell phones, laptops and any other devices draw in some charge when they’re plugged in and aren’t being used.

If you heat your home with fuel oil, inquire about switching over to biodiesel. Depending on your system, you may be able to switch to biodiesel without having to make any modifications to your system. Biodiesel is cleaner to burn than petroleum, making it more efficient to use in the wintertime.

Solar water heaters are an inexpensive and efficient way to heat your home’s water. If you live somewhere where you don’t have to be concerned with temperatures that are freezing, you can use a system that circulates water through the solar heater before it gets pumped into your home. Don’t get rid of your conventional water heater though; you may need it if it’s cloudy when you’re ready to use hot water.

If you are considering the installation of home solar energy, make sure you are aware of how much energy you will receive during the winter months. Using this metric means you will meet your energy needs in the winter, while greatly exceeding them in the summer. Combining this method with a net utilities plan will mean getting back money from the electric company during the summer, too.
